Four articles from the Peking University Department of Urology and Andrology have been cited in the 2024 European Urological Association (EAU) guidelines (EAU-Guidelines-on-Sexual-and-Reproductive-Health-2024).

The EAU and AUA guidelines are the most frequently referenced and cited international guidelines for urological andrologists, and the EAU guidelines are updated every year with reference to new literature developments, and new conclusions, new perspectives and new concepts are constantly added. The EAU Sexual and Reproductive Health Guidelines include erectile dysfunction, premature ejaculation, male infertility, etc., and 2 of the 4 articles cited by the Peking University urology and andrology team are related to premature ejaculation and 2 are related to male reproduction.

In the section of the EAU guideline, the results of a multi-center phase IV clinical trial published by the urology and andrology team of Peking University pointed out that the treatment effect of dapoxetine for primary and secondary premature ejaculation is similar, and the common side effects are dose-dependent.

The premature ejaculation section of the guideline also cites the results of a real-world study by the urology and andrology team at Peking University, which states that the main reasons for early discontinuation of the drug in patients with premature ejaculation are poor results, side effects, and low frequency of sex. For the first time, the number of tics was used as an evaluation index for premature ejaculation in clinical practice to make up for the shortcomings of previous subjective evaluation.

Since its establishment in 2005, the team of the Department of Urology and Andrology of Peking University has begun to explore microsurgical techniques for the treatment of male infertility, and has published a total of 14 articles, some of which have been cited 176 times by the library of Peking University Hospital.

The male infertility section of the 2024EAU guidelines cites data published in Fertility and Sterility by the urology and andrology team of Peking University in 2015, which shows that natural pregnancy can be achieved from 6 to 12 months after microspermatic vein ligation, of course, with the extension of follow-up time, the natural pregnancy rate is higher, and the overall pregnancy rate can reach 45.5% in 2 years.

For patients with acquired epididymal obstruction and normal reproductive function of their spouses, guidelines recommend microscopic vasectomy epididymal anastomosis, which can achieve high recanalization and pregnancy rates. An article published in Human Production in 2017 by the Peking University Department of Urology and Andrology demonstrated that microsurgery is the first choice for patients with epididymal obstruction through a large sample size.

These four clinical papers have been consecutively cited in the 2022, 2023, and 2024 EAU guidelines. At present, the urology andrology team of Peking University is working on 3 general projects of the National Natural Science Foundation of China and 2 general projects of the Beijing Natural Science Foundation, and has established a long-term scientific research cooperation mechanism with the Institute of Biophysics of the Chinese Academy of Sciences and the Institute of Basic Research of the Chinese Academy of Medical Sciences.
